COA Solutions’ Half-Year Results Buck Industry Trend with 24% Increase in New Business Licence Orders

UK business applications software provider, COA Solutions (www.coasolutions.com), today reports solid financial results for the six months ending 30 September 2009. Revenue of £28.6m [2008: £29.6m] was on budget and ear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ation and amortisation (EBITDA) were 18% ahead of budget at £6.4m [2008: £5.1m].

In contrast to the general trends that have depressed sales across the business software sector, total orders increased by 6% and licence orders increased 13% with orders from new customers increasing by 24% over the same period last year.

Mark Thompson, Managing Director of COA Solutions says, “The recessionary climate has caused the business applications software market to plateau with the impact being most severe on new business opportunities as a result of potential customers locking-down capital expenditure. To have bucked the industry trend with a considerable increase in new business licence orders is therefore highly encouraging.” 

Thompson continues, “Recurring revenues have increased by 3%, accounting for 53% of total revenue. This is as a direct result of the success of our COA Solutions On Demand managed and bureau service offerings. The performance of our company over the first-half of the year is further testimony to the resilience of our business model against a backdrop of continued economic volatility.”

Financial half-year highlights include:
• Revenue on budget at £28.6m with EBITDA 18% ahead of budget at £6.4m
• EBITDA of £6.4m increased 25% over the same period in 2008
• EBITDA grew from 17% to 23% of revenue
• Revenue mix: 22% licence, 53% recurring and 25% services [2008: 20%: 49%: 31%]
• Total orders up by 6%
• Licence orders up by 13%
• 24% increase in new business licence orders
• 3% increase in recurring revenues due to COA Solutions on Demand gaining momentum
• Gross margin increased by 4% points to 61%
• Undelivered services orders increased by 2% and provides 6 months backlog
• Research and development headcount increased from 25% of worldwide headcount to 33%

 

About COA Solutions www.coasolutions.com    

COA Solutions is the UK's leading supplier of integrated business management and information systems to public, private and not-for-profit organisations in the service sector. COA Solutions prides itself on getting close to its customers by understanding their businesses and responding to their business needs.

COA Solutions' award-winning Smart Business Suite combines core financial management, procurement, human resource and payroll systems, integrated with a range of collaborative, document management and business intelligence solutions. COA Solutions also provides managed service and bureau service options. Its systems and services extend the value and effectiveness of the finance, HR and payroll departments across the organisation and enable managers in the business to monitor, analyse and continually improve corporate performance.
 
COA Solutions has more than 500 experienced and professional staff supporting and servicing over 4,000 clients across the UK service sector including Companies House, Newcastle City Council, WHSmith, Royal Bank of Scotland, Aer Lingus, National Express Group, DFS, RSPB and Great Ormond Street Hospital for Children NHS Trust.
